Wofai Fada Welcomes First Child with Husband Taiwo Cole

By   Milcah   Tanimu

Nigerian actress and comedian Wofai Fada has become a mother. She joyfully announced the birth of her first child, a baby girl, on Instagram on Sunday, December 1, 2024. The actress expressed gratitude for the “precious gift,” sharing her excitement with fans, friends, and followers.

“Forever grateful to God for this precious gift ❤️. Our princess is here. My joy is complete ❤️❤️❤️,” Wofai wrote in the post.

The news sparked an outpouring of congratulatory messages from notable figures. Actress Maria Chike Benjamin sent warm wishes, writing, “Congratulations beautiful mama!!! Aww May God treasure her all the days of her life ❤️❤️❤️.” Regina Daniels and Omoni Oboli also expressed their joy for the new parents.

Wofai had previously shared her engagement to Taiwo Cole on May 4, 2024, with loved-up photos on Instagram. The couple followed with a traditional wedding in Ugep, Cross River State, though it was later clarified by Taiwo’s family that they were unaware of and had not approved the wedding.

Nonetheless, the couple is now celebrating their new arrival, with their baby girl completing their family.
